PostgreSQL में आप डेटा प्रकार वर्ण भिन्नता (लंबाई परिशुद्धता के बिना) या इस तरह से पाठ के साथ एक कॉलम बना सकते हैं :
ALTER TABLE test ADD COLUMN c1 varchar;
ALTER TABLE test ADD COLUMN c2 text;
क्या इन दो डेटा प्रकारों के बीच अंतर है?
प्रलेखन इसके बारे में स्पष्ट नहीं है। वे कहते हैं :
यदि वर्ण भिन्नता का उपयोग लंबाई निर्दिष्ट किए बिना किया जाता है, तो टाइप किसी भी आकार के तारों को स्वीकार करता है।
[...]
इसके अलावा, PostgreSQL पाठ प्रकार प्रदान करता है , जो किसी भी लम्बाई के तारों को संग्रहीत करता है।
ऐसा लगता है कि ये दो डेटाटेप समान हैं, लेकिन यह स्पष्ट नहीं है ... इसके बारे में अधिक जानकारी?
धन्यवाद, निको
7
पर जवाब देखें serverfault.com
—
डैनियल verité